      <description>Theme Hospital is a simulation computer game developed by Bullfrog Productions and published by Electronic Arts in 1997, in which the player designs and operates a hospital. Like most of Bullfrog's games, Theme Hospital is permeated by an eccentric sense of humor. The game is the thematic successor to Theme Park, a game also produced by Bullfrog.

      <description>Sony Vegas is a non-linear editing system originally published by Sonic Foundry, now owned and run by Sony Creative Software. It is designed to be used on Microsoft Windows XP and Vista. In April 2007, Sony along with AMD jointly demonstrated a 64-bit version of Vegas running on 64-bit Vista. Originally developed as an audio editor, it eventually developed into an NLE for video and audio from version 2.0. Vegas features real-time multitrack video and audio editing on unlimited tracks, resolution-independent video sequencing, complex effects and compositing tools, 24-bit/192 kHz audio support, VST and DirectX plug-in effect support, and Dolby Digital surround sound mixing.</description>

      <description>RuneScape is a Java-based MMORPG (Massively Multiplayer Online Role Playing Game) operated by Jagex Ltd. It has approximately five million active free accounts and more than one million paid member accounts. Starting off as RuneScape Classic, the graphics have changed immensely over the years. </description>

      <description>Ragnarok Online is a cartoon-Based massively multiplayer online role-playing game with 3D backgrounds and 2D characters with detailed graphic feature.

It is created by GRAVITY Co., Ltd. based on the manhwa Ragnarok by Lee Myung-jin.

It was first released in South Korea on 31 August 2001 for Microsoft Windows and has since been released in many other locales around the world. Much of the game's mythos is based on Norse mythology, but its style has been influenced by Christianity and Asian cultures. </description>

      <description>PuTTY is a client program for the SSH, Telnet and Rlogin network protocols, plus Serial Port communications, it is perhaps the most popular tools on the Windows platform as OS X and Linux have terminals built in for this.</description>
